| Reverse description | The central device depicts a family of four — a mother, father, and two children — standing together within a downward-pointing triangular compositional frame, symbolising family planning. Two wheat ears flank the lower portion of the central design, evoking the FAO theme of agricultural sufficiency. The date '1974' appears below the family group within the triangle. The bilingual circular legend reads 'PLANNED FAMILIES:FOOD FOR ALL' in Latin script and 'नियोजित परिवार:सबके लिए अनाज' in Devanagari script, distributed around the scalloped periphery of the coin. |
